Magnetotelluric(MT) is a method with well prospect for the detection of the earth deep structure and state of material. It plays a significant role in the earth electromagnetic induction branch of Geophysics. People can obtain the electrical structure of the crust and upper mantle in observation area through further processing and inversion towards the data acquired by MT method. And by analyzing the electrical structure, the geologic structure of observation area will be acquired preliminarily, and then the position of subsurface structure edge, including faults and anomalous bodies.Through the data collection, processing and inversion, the ultimate result is a series resistivity map of target areas. And the judgment of geologic structure in these areas derived from analysis towards these map. Therefore, it is necessary to introduce Digital Image Processing to the interpretation process so that artificial deviation can be overcome to some extent. Image Segmentation is a critical area of DIP, and several mature methods have been developed in other fields so far. Modifying these methods and applying them to resistivity map so to support the deside of edge is the content of this paper.I have searched established methods in Image Segmentation, and have screened out some methods with development prospects according to the property of resistivity map, including Region Splitting and Merging, Region Growing, Morphological Watersheds and Relaxation method. Meanwhile, I have researched auxiliary tools that can be used when implementing these methods, including edge detectors and morphological processing. These methods above have been carried out preliminarily via MATLAB language. Then I established a series of typical subsurface structure models, obtained MT forward response, finally acquired inversion result. Those algorithms were modified according to the property of resistivity map. Finally, different segmentation results through these methods have been compared to the original models.Through the discussion above, thesis put forward a method of region expansion with self-adaption. To some degree, we can acquire electrical edge and support geological interpretation through it.
